The primary narrative driver of Episode 1 is structural dramatic irony. Savitri’s biological sons, Kapil (Varun Mitra) and Harish (Ashish Verma), live entirely clueless, soft lives abroad in the United States, believing their mother runs a simple embroidery and tea business.
